Developing an excellent mobile app needs a lot of experience and skills. An idea of a mobile application for a business is not optional anymore. Since customers normally spend most of their time on mobile applications than that of websites. And if a business does not have an app, then it is definitely missing a good chance to maximize revenue.
Android and iOS application have marked their strong presence in application development industry. It is fair enough to say that both platforms have delivered useful features and functionality to bring seamless work environment in business operations. On the other side, application development has created enormous opportunities for job seekers to flourish their career as a iOS or Android app developer. So in a crowd of application developers, things become challenging for businesses to hire mobile app designer.
Below are important guidelines for the company to hire right application developers for their project:
Clear Description Of Mobile App Requirements
Businesses will not get desired output until they clearly define proper requirements for application development project. Many companies are afraid of exposing project details with the interviewer as they think that someone might rob their ideas.
But, under copyright agreement companies can take legal action against theft. Hence, the company should describe actual project requirements with a candidate. This will help candidates to know the structure of project so that they can make further preparation to get involved in a particular project.
Check Relevant Experience
Well, checking relevant experience in application development is key element while hiring developers. The company should check the experience of the candidate on the basis of the requirements. For example, years of experience in developing gaming application might not be suitable for eCommerce app development. Therefore company should check whether the candidate has the ability to develop applications for multiple categories or just one. To develop robust and flawless applications, the company should hire expert app developer in the relevant area.
Offshore Development Company Can Help To Save Extra Money
The cost of application development depends on numerous factors such as platform, resources, wages for developers, features and more. And cost keeps changing project by project. So, instead of hiring app developers, offshoring mobile application development can be a good idea. Today, many offshore app development companies are available at affordable cost. But, before hiring an offshore development, the company should sign a legal ownership contract and payment agreement policies.
Hire Developer Who Can Guide Rest Of Employees
A decent application development company not only develop an effective app but also guide its employee in right direction. It would be beneficial for the company to hire a developer who can guide different teams according to the latest trends and technologies. Because such developers have already worked with many clients and employees around the globe.
Keep The Quality First Instead Of Cost
Each business and company have specified budget for projects. But, most of the times, a low-cost option can become expensive in application development world. There might be a chance that hiring a low-cost developer can produce a high outcome for the business and vice versa. Therefore compromise with quality can turn business upside down. Hence it is better the take account of work quality of developers instead of their high payment demands.
Deadline And Budget
Application budget and deadline are equally important factors as quality and performance of an application. The company may find a valid developer, but it is important to hire one who delivers effective solutions for a project within the given project deadline.
It is important for companies to hire app developers who are technically capable of completing the desired project. The company should inspect technical knowledge of developers by considering the project requirements. For example, complex app development project might require team Android developers, iOS developers, UI/UX designer, backend (database) developer.
The company should aware of fact that one developer doesn’t have the ability to handle all these technical skills. Therefore, the company needs to hire multiple developers with various disciplines. Hiring a team is always beneficial as all developers will work under one roof and able to communicate effectively.
Upgrades And Maintenance Plan
All the major application platforms update their versions regularly. Unfortunately, these updates may cause crashing of a mobile application. For example, when app developed with an older version of SDK might not compatible with the newer version.
Hence, the company should ask developers how they are going to handle such version compatibility issues. The company should Freelance app designer who has knowledge of different troubleshooting techniques. To keep application evolving, developers should be able to handle upgrades efficiently.
Communication Throughout The Project
Communication with developers become a thing of matter in application development. Things like time zone, language and any other issues can cause an interruption in proper communication. So the company should decide with developers on a mode of communication throughout the project. The company can communicate with developers via phone calls, emails, video call. More the proper communication, smoother the development process will go. This will always help to obtain consistency and reliability in application development.